  • Either set the collision mask to bounding box

    or update your collision polygons, because they are not straight.

    Also make sure the collision masks of your objects arent overlapping.

  • Your polygons are not straight.

    When they are straight there will be no movement.

    While editing the polygons look at the top of the image editor and select one of the points, you'll see the exact position. your polygons were at y-1.21 and y-1.35 or something like that. that isn't straight.

    So there is a solution and that is fixing your polygons.

  • Instead of moving the colission points with the mouse enter their coordinates at the top of the image editor. Do this in the first frame of the animation, than right-click and choose use for whole animation.

  • That I do but I do not work for me ... I have a 33*32 item do the same as you and still moving ... despair of that game :(

  • It should work, because that's what I did in my updated capx.

    But maybe it would be a better idea for you to set the collision to bounding box. You can find this setting on the left in the physics settings.

    If this doesnt work as expected, maybe you should cut of the transparent pixels at the edges of your sprites.
